Installation Notes
Installation is straightforward – just remove the old hardened rubber and press the new seals into the grooves around the hood opening. Clean out any old rubber bits first so the new seals seat properly. While you’ve got the hood up, it’s a good time to check your air cleaner and look for any other worn seals that might need attention.
